Popular Questions About Geography

What are the 5 types of geography?
The five themes of Geography are Location, Place, Human-Environment Interaction, Movement, and Region. Location is defined as a particular place or position. Most studies of geography begin with the mention of this theme of geography. Location can be of two types: absolute location and relative location.
Why is geography considered a science?
Geography is considered a science because it uses the scientific method and upholds scientific principles and logic. Inventions such as the compass, geographic information systems, global positioning systems and remote sensing would not have been possible without geography.
What is geography best described as?
Geography is described as a spatial science because it focuses is on "where" things are and why they occur there. Geographers seek to answer all or more than one of four basic questions when studying our environment. These relate to location, place, spatial pattern, and spatial interaction.
